  • I was given this old chair which is quite wobbly so I scrubbed it up and used CeCe Caldwell's Montana Blue Sky on the base and back.
  • Then I free-handed some waves with Annie Sloan's Old Ochre and Emperor's Silk. I love chalk paint no sanding or priming needed!
  • I then took my palm sander to it and heavily distressed it and used a sanding block for the tight spots.
  • See 2 more photos

Patriotic Chair Decor

I love to take old chairs, that are not stable enough for use, and turn them in to decor pieces. Since it's summer, I gave this chair a little patriotic flavor with red, white and blue. ...»
